We have an exciting opportunity for an AI Adoption & Enablement Specialist to join Norgine in a global role. The person holding this position will report to the AI Programme Lead (or equivalent). The core responsibility of this role is to drive adoption of AI tools and ways of working, while supporting governance and enabling colleagues to deliver value from AI in their everyday work. This is a 12-month fixed-term contract.

Requirements

  • Strong communication and presentation skills, with the ability to engage diverse audiences
  • Experience supporting digital adoption, training, or technology implementation
  • Ability to analyse data and generate insights to support decision-making
  • Good understanding of governance, policies, and structured processes
  • Strong organisational and planning skills with the ability to manage multiple priorities
  • Understanding of AI concepts and interest in AI-driven ways of working
  • Ability to work independently and coordinate activities across teams

KEY R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Manage and grow the AI Ambassadors community, ensuring consistent engagement and onboarding
  • Deliver internal communications and training to increase AI adoption across the organisation
  • Provide user support and guidance on AI tools, including Microsoft Copilot
  • Support AI governance processes, including use case intake, tracking, and review coordination
  • Monitor and report on adoption metrics, translating insights into actionable improvements
  • Collaborate with stakeholders and partners to deliver AI initiatives effectively
  • Contribute to continuous improvement, bringing ideas to enhance AI practices and impact
